Here is the recipe for my urban fighters camo with a few pics to give you the idea...

Undercoat Chaos Black (Undercoat spray is fine on plastics, but you'll need to base coat metal models with paint).
Drybrush/Overbrush with Adeptus Battlegrey (leave the deepest recesses black).
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_5912
(I did this on the armour and cloth parts, but you could use a contrasting colour)

Wash armour with Badab Black (or Devlan Mud depending on taste).

Edge the armour only with Fortress Grey.

On each armour plate paint random splodges of Fortress Grey (this is a good way of tidying up inaccurate edging), ensuring that you only paint a 'splodge' on one part of the armour. IMPORTANT: Don't continue a 'splodge' from one armour section onto another part of the armour/cloth or the camo will look false and you will lose definition on the model.
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_5914

Next using a 1:1 (roughly) mix of Chaos Black and Codex Grey to create darker camo splodges.

Finally, spot small amounts of Astronomicon Grey on the armour and your done!

Ork Example...
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_6044
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_6045
Base Coat: Knarloc Green (Wash Black and Green)
Snakebite Leather Splodges
Gretchin Green Splodges
Rotted Flesh Flashes

The recipe for this camouflage is...
Undercoat: Black
Basecoat: Charadon Granite
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7710

Wash: 50:50 mix Ogryn Flesh/Devlan Mud
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7715

Camo 1: Catachan Green
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7714
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7712

Camo 2: Camo Green
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7713

Camo 3: Gretchin Green
(No edge highlights - I think that works better on IG armour than orks)
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Img_7711

Another mud wash will probably work well!

These are a couple figs I painted awhile ago trying to test different schemes. I went with a peadot pattern similar to a wwii german scheme.

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... DSC01512

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... DSC01510

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... DSC01513

The scheme is fairly simple to do. Im not going to list exact manufacturers colors because I tend to mix alot of my paints and use various manufacturers paints.
1. Paint the entire area in a yellow ochre color
2. Paint the brown splotches in irregular blob shapes and place small dots randomly around
3. Same as above but use a dark green color
4. Using a light green place small dots in the green area
5. The model on the left also has lighter yellow ochre spots
6. Using inks or washes apply a pin wash to the folds. Not I do not wash the entire area only in the recesses
7. Use a sand or bone white apply a thin highlight to the very edges of the crease. Do not over do this stage or you will ruin the camo pattern
Then paint the remaining areas of the model. I usually choose a solid color to provide something for the eyes to focus on unless I am painting moderns or something more accurate to real life.

I've got two squads of Cadians that I'm wanting to paint in urban camo. I did a test paint and everything looked fine. Then I gave it a black wash and it completely ruined the camo. One of these tutorials says to wash the base coat then paint on the camo. The other says to apply the wash directly into the creases and folds. Which do you think is the better method?
Back to top Go down
Laney

Laney


Posts : 3352
Join date : 2010-02-13
Age : 47
Location : Colchester, Essex, England

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... Empty
PostSubject: Re: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more...   Great Death Squads Camo Tutorials: Urban, Traditional and more... I_icon_minitimeSat Mar 31, 2012 12:54 pm

That depends. Doomie's camo is a proper expert effort and advises a pin wash in the folds and looks great. My methods usually require a wash over the basecoat, because that requires a lower skill level to get working right, however a heavy handed camo over the top can ruin the effect of depth. Washing after the camo is complete would probably work best if it was a very thinned down wash, otherwise it will obscure the camo (I wouldn't recommend it). Black washes are often used and might be a little heavy handed over the pale colours.
